Howdy StealthLlama,

Your crash is an Access Violation so the game is interacting with memory and a value is not returning as it should. I also noticed the game is making calls to your OneDrive\Documents\WarCraft III. I recommend the following 2 steps:

  1. Desync OneDrive from backing up Documents\Warcraft III folder following the steps Here.

  2. Disable all Windows startup programs to help rule out a third-party software conflict following the steps Here. Restart the PC and retest.

Note: Undo any compatibility steps you did, shouldn’t need them for this type of crash.
